How do I know if I'm making a profit?
How do I know if I'm making a profit?
Yes, it's quite easy to know if you're making profit from your equity investment. You are making a profit if there is an increase in value, higher than the price you paid for your equity. Your regular portfolio check will let you compare the buying price against the market price every now and then.
